Aspect Niseko Celebrates Multiple Awards

Aspect is proud to announce that we have been globally recognised as 2021’s Top 20 Accommodations in Niseko. This is the 2nd consecutive year Aspect has achieved this award category by Travelmyth, a marked improvement from Top 50 in 2020. In addition, Aspect has also set a significant milestone this year as Niseko’s go-to luxury resort by achieving Featured Luxury Accommodation, Top 10 Small Accommodations and Featured Accommodation with Parking in Niseko.

On behalf of the Aspect team, we would like to convey our sincere appreciation and gratitude to all our guests who have contributed positively toward this inspiring achievement. This is a testament of our dedication and commitment in providing high-quality services and personalised, memorable experiences to our guests who ‘Expect the Exceptional’.

Aspect will continue to be worthy of this recognition and looks forward to welcoming our guests back to Niseko again soon.

Aspect Niseko offers a total of 11 spacious apartments in combinations of two, three or five bedrooms; which were thoughtfully designed by world-renowned firm Riccardo Tossani Architecture with high-end European and Japanese furnishings.

Each apartment has its own a private balcony and features large floor-to-ceiling windows that allow natural light to illuminate the room while offering magnificent views of Mt Yotei and the surrounding Hirafu Village. All apartments come complete with fully-equipped kitchens, modern appliances and necessary utensils as well as private laundry rooms with washer and dryer.

Aspect is located on the famed “Millionaire’s Row” in Hirafu Village, Niseko’s main hub of activity and only minutes away from Niseko’s most exceptional experiences such as worldclass fine dining, relaxing onsen, exciting events and trendy bars.

Aspect is also one of few luxury holiday properties in Niseko that offer exclusive ski valet services to its guests who enjoy the slopes, which includes private chauffer service to and from the ski hill. Our ski valet will look after AND store your ski equipment during your stay until you are ready to zip through Niseko’s famous powder snow once again. Parking is also available on the property.

Located on Japan’s northern island of Hokkaido, Niseko is one of the Top 10 ski resorts in the world and famous for its world-renowned powder snow (commonly known as “japow”. The soft, fluffy powder snow is caused by unique weather conditions over the Sea of Japan and can sometimes reach up to 3 metres in depth on heavy snowfall days. Niseko is also home to Mt Yotei, one of the highest peaks in Hokkaido at 1,898m tall and is also known as “Hokkaido’s Mt Fuji” or “Ezo Fuji”.
